Events International Ltd is seeking a Senior Event Manager in Tewkesbury to oversee the operational delivery of its event portfolio. This role includes ensuring high-quality, bespoke corporate hospitality programmes are executed seamlessly, with responsibility spanning from planning through to live events.
Applicants should have substantial experience in events or corporate hospitality, demonstrate strong leadership skills, and possess a proactive approach to managing operational challenges. The position involves UK and overseas travel, making strong organizational skills essential.
